Blockchain and artificial intelligence have been responsible for changing the traditional systems, processes and infrastructures in various industries. The popularity of both technologies creates a lot of problems for people who want to pursue a career in modern technology. Blockchain primarily focuses on decentralization, cryptographic security and cryptocurrencies. On the other hand, AI is all about machine learning, deep learning, data analysis and automation. Beginners need a blockchain developer vs. AI developer comparison to find the best choice for their career. Let us learn about the difference between blockchain developer and artificial intelligence developer careers.

Build your identity as a certified blockchain & AI expert with 101 Blockchains’ Blockchain & AI Certifications designed to provide enhanced career prospects.

Understanding the Fundamental Difference between AI and Blockchain 

You need a better understanding of the differences between AI and blockchain to understand how blockchain developers are different from AI developers. Blockchain has changed the approaches for storing and managing data with the advantages of cryptographic security and transparency. The digital ledger is available on multiple computers connected in the network and helps in maintaining track of data or transactions on all nodes. The most unique detail of blockchain is that it is immutable and you cannot modify or erase information added to the blockchain. Decentralization is another crucial feature of blockchain that prevents a central authority from taking control over the network.

Artificial intelligence is a branch of computer science aimed at making computers think like humans. You might seek insights on blockchain vs. AI for career prospects owing to the rising popularity of AI. You must know that artificial intelligence involves making machines learn from experience to recognize patterns and solve problems. Subdomains of AI such as deep learning have been striving to develop cognitive abilities of humans in machines. The evolution of artificial intelligence makes its more efficient and smarter over the course of time.

Certified Enterprise Blockchain Professional Certification

Do You Want to Become a Blockchain Developer or AI Developer?

Blockchain and artificial intelligence are the two most powerful technologies to transform traditional systems and business operations across different industries. While some experts believe that AI may outpace blockchain in terms of opportunities for professional growth, you can expect blockchain and AI to work together in future. 

You can choose to work as a blockchain developer or AI developer, depending on your career goals, skills and interests. There are many factors such as blockchain developer salary and skills required for becoming an AI developer that you must consider before making a choice. It is important to remember that the difference between careers in blockchain and AI primarily revolves around their focus.

Blockchain development focuses on creating decentralized applications and systems for exchanging information or value. On the other hand, AI development emphasizes the creation of intelligent systems that have the capabilities for learning, reasoning and continuous improvement. Let us dive deeper into the differences between the job of blockchain developers and AI developers in the following sections. 

  • Skills Required for the Job 

One of the most crucial pointers for comparing blockchain developers with AI developers is the outline of skills needed for the job. Blockchain developers need fluency in one of the programming languages among JavaScript, Python, Go and C++. In addition, you must have command over Solidity programming to become blockchain developers. As a blockchain developer, you must also know about the utilities of blockchain development platforms such as Ethereum and Hyperledger. Blockchain developers also need in-depth understanding of cryptography principles and concepts alongside data structures and networking. 

The blockchain vs. AI salary comparison will also revolve around the skills required to become AI developers. Artificial intelligence developers also need programming skills in Python, Java, C++ and R. Python is the most useful programming language for AI developers as it includes many libraries and tools for machine learning. AI developers must have strong command over mathematics and statistics with specialization in linear algebra, probability and calculus. Another crucial skill required for AI developer jobs is data science and ability to use tools for data manipulation, visualization and processing. AI developers should also have the ability to use machine learning frameworks such as PyTorch and TensorFlow.

Apart from the technical skills, blockchain developers and AI developers also need soft skills such as communication and collaboration. Both the roles require professionals to become more adaptable and think out of the box to craft innovative solutions. Most important of all, blockchain development and AI development require attention to detail while designing new solutions and writing code. 

Start learning blockchain and AI with world’s first Blockchain & AI Skill Paths with quality resources tailored by industry experts now!

  • Responsibilities on the Job 

The next point for comparison between blockchain developer and AI developer will focus on the responsibilities you have on the job. Blockchain developers focus on development and maintenance of blockchain protocols and decentralized applications. The responsibilities of blockchain developers include creation of blockchain systems, writing smart contract code and ensuring security of blockchain networks. Blockchain developers must also monitor the performance of blockchain protocols and dApps to optimize them according to evolving requirements. 

You might have doubts like ‘Which is better to learn machine learning or blockchain?’ upon learning about the responsibilities of blockchain developers. Interestingly, the responsibilities of AI developers also present complex challenges. An AI developer must create models and algorithms that help machines perform tasks like humans. The primary responsibility of AI developers focuses on creating machine learning models and training them with the help of large datasets. AI developers also create applications that use NLP for understand and processing natural human language alongside integrating AI capabilities in various applications.

  • Availability of Job Prospects

Candidates seeking job opportunities in blockchain and AI development are also likely to worry about the availability of jobs. The good news is that the demand for blockchain developers and AI developers is increasing steadily across different industries. Blockchain development is one of the top jobs on LinkedIn and industries such as finance, supply chain management and healthcare have been hiring blockchain development experts. 

Artificial intelligence developers have also become one of the in-demand roles in the technology job market. AI developers can find jobs in healthcare, entertainment, finance and automotive among many other industries. The most promising thing about job prospects for AI developers is the flexibility to choose different roles. As a skilled AI developer, you can become a NLP expert, an AI researcher or a machine learning engineer. Research by the World Economic Forum suggests that AI experts will be immune to disruptions in the global job market in future. 

Unlock your potential in Artificial Intelligence with the Certified AI Professional (CAIP)™ Certification. Elevate your career with expert-led training and gain the skills needed to thrive in today’s AI-driven world.

  • Expectations for Salary 

The most important thing that anyone will look for in comparisons between blockchain developers and AI developers is the salary. The salary represents the reward that you will get in return for investing efforts and dedicated hard work to become a trusted expert. Blockchain developers can earn almost $90,000 to $150,000 per year while senior developers can get an annual salary of $225,000. 

The average AI developer salary is slightly better than that of blockchain developers. Artificial intelligence developers can earn around $100,000 to $160,000 per year in the initial stages of their career. As they grow further, AI developers can land up with specialized roles that pay higher salary ranging up to $300,000.

  • Difficulty of Learning 

The difficulty of learning required for becoming blockchain developer and AI developer also serves as a valuable point for comparison between the roles. The learning curve will be different for blockchain developers and AI developers as both roles demand distinctive skills. Blockchain developers will have to build their way through an understanding of concepts like decentralization, cryptography and consensus mechanisms. The availability of multiple online resources to learn blockchain allows you to gain knowledge required for various blockchain roles. 

AI developers must develop a strong foundation in subjects of mathematics, computer science and statistics. You will also experience some difficulties in learning about machine learning frameworks and working with large datasets. However, involvement with more AI development projects will simplify the learning curve for any AI developer. 

Here is an outline of the differences between the career paths of blockchain developers and AI developers.

blockchain developer vs ai developer

Which Option is the Best for You?

The comparison of blockchain vs. AI for career development might have helped you find the ideal option. It is also important to pay attention to other factors before choosing a career path in modern technology. First of all, you must find the domain you are interested in rather than following the popular pick. You must also evaluate your skillset for blockchain and AI development to determine the job where you will perform better. Most important of all, candidates should measure the market demand and future prospects in both roles to weigh out the best choice for their career.

Final Thoughts 

The rising demand for careers in blockchain and AI has left many candidates confused. Professionals aspiring to build a career in modern technology don’t have a clue about the implications of careers in blockchain and AI. As a matter of fact, most people believe that blockchain and AI are lucrative job options as they offer six-figure salaries. It is important to review the differences between the role of blockchain developer and AI developer before you pick a career path. Learn about the differences between blockchain developer and AI developer roles to build your career right now. 

Unlock your career with 101 Blockchains' Learning Programs

*Disclaimer: The article should not be taken as, and is not intended to provide any investment advice. Claims made in this article do not constitute investment advice and should not be taken as such. 101 Blockchains shall not be responsible for any loss sustained by any person who relies on this article. Do your own research!